Introduction:

Localization has become an increasingly important aspect of supply chain management in recent years. The concept of localization involves tailoring goods and services to meet the specific needs and preferences of local customers. In supply chains, localization refers to the integration of local resources, knowledge, and capabilities into the design, production, and delivery of goods and services.
